I've read the MSDN documentation on how Dictionary.ContainsKey() works, but I was wondering how it actually makes the equality comparison? Basically, I have a dictionary keyed to a reference type* and I want the ContainsKey() method to check a certain property of that reference type as its basis for determining if the key exists or not. For example, if I had a Dictionary(MyObject, int) and MyObject has a public property (of int) called "TypeID", could I get ContainsKey(MyObject myObject) to check to see if one of the keys has a TypeID that is equal to myObject? Could I just overload the == operator?
- The reference type is an object called "Duration" which holds a value (
double Length); "Duration" is a base type used in my music program to denote how long a particular sound lasts. I derive classes from it which incorporate more sophisticated timing concepts, like Western musical time signatures, but want all of them to be comparable in terms of their length.
